#702951 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#702951 is composed of 43.9% red, 16.1%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.4% magenta, 27.7%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 326.2 degrees, a saturation of 46.4% and a lightness of 30%. #702951 color hex could be obtained by blending #e052a2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#702951 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#702951 has RGB values of R:112, G:41,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.28,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7350609.
